HBO Max has launched a dedicated vertical video Shorts feed, aiming to enhance content discovery and engage users as viewing habits shift towards short-form media.

The Popularity of Short-Form Content

The rise of short-form content on platforms like TikTok and Instagram Reels has reshaped how audiences consume media. Users increasingly prefer quick, digestible snippets over lengthy viewing. By integrating a Shorts feature, HBO Max aims to capture this audience, making it easier for users to discover content that suits their tastes in a fast-paced media landscape.

The Advantages of Vertical Video

Adopting a vertical video format presents several benefits for both viewers and content creators. This approach not only enhances the viewing experience on mobile devices but also allows for creative storytelling within a limited time frame.

Enhanced User Experience

Vertical videos occupy the full screen on smartphones, providing an immersive experience. This format eliminates distractions, making it simpler for users to engage with the content. As mobile usage continues to soar in markets like Southeast Asia, the potential for vertical videos becomes even more significant.
